Yarn does this quickly, … WebMar 17, 2024 · We need to create the REACT_APP_API_KEY variable in an .env file. Securing the sensitive data. React provides a way to secure the data that is sent to the API. We’ll just create an .env file and add the REACT_APP_API_KEY variable. When working with React and environment variables, make sure all your environment variables start with REACT_APP_.

WebJan 25, 2024 · To get started, create a react-app using $ yarn create react-app todo && cd my-app and install firebase-tools globally by running $ yarn global add firebase-tools. Run $ firebase login to authenticate yourself. To create a Firebase project, run $ firebase projects:create and enter a unique ID.
